Understanding Medical Malpractice
Before we dive deeper into its emotional impact, let’s clarify what constitutes medical malpractice.

- Definition: Medical malpractice occurs when a healthcare professional deviates from the standards of care in their profession, resulting in harm to a patient. Common Types: Misdiagnosis or delayed diagnosis Surgical errors Medication mistakes Birth injuries
Recognizing these factors helps us understand how deeply personal and damaging medical malpractice can be.

Long-Term Psychological Effects
The aftermath of medical malpractice often extends well beyond immediate emotional reactions. Patients may develop long-term psychological issues such as:
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D): Many individuals experience flashbacks or nightmares related to their medical experiences. Depression: The feeling of hopelessness can take root when individuals grapple with their new reality post-malpractice. Anxiety Disorders: Constant worry about health outcomes or revisiting healthcare settings can lead to chronic anxiety.It’s essential for victims to recognize these potential effects early on.

Understanding the Legal Process
Navigating the legal landscape surrounding medical malpractice requires knowledge:
- Consultation with Attorneys: Engaging with specialized lawyers who understand medical laws is crucial. Gathering Evidence: Documentation like medical records, expert testimonies, and witness statements become vital components of building a case.

What should I do if I suspect I've been a victim of medical malpractice?
If you suspect you've been harmed due to negligence:
Seek immediate medical evaluation if necessary. Document everything related; keep records meticulously! Consult an attorney specializing in this field promptly!How long do I have to file a lawsuit?
Statutes vary state-by-state but typically range between one year up until several years after discovering harm occurred! Always consult local laws soonest possible!
Can emotional damages be compensated?
Yes! Beyond physical damages incurred arising out-of-negligent circumstances—emotional distress claims exist within many jurisdictions recognizing psychological impacts suffered!
Do I need expert testimony?
In most cases yes; expert witnesses help establish standards-of-care violations establishing causation linking negligent acts directly impacting patient outcomes!
